NEWS
History - getEnabledDPs hängt wenn Adapter deaktiviert ist
-
Systemdata Bitte Ausfüllen Hardwaresystem: Pi3 Arbeitsspeicher: 1GB Festplattenart: SD-Karte Betriebssystem: Debian GNU/Linux Node-Version: 12.22.0 Nodejs-Version: 12.22.0 NPM-Version: 6.14.11 Installationsart: Manuell Image genutzt: Nein History Adapter Version: 1.9.12 Die Funktion getEnabledDPs bleibt beim Aufruf aus meinem Adapter (fb-checkpresence) hängen, wenn der History Adapter deaktivert ist. Es wäre gut, wenn die Funktion getEnabledDPs nach einer gewissen Zeit einen Fehler zurückmelden würde. Sie bleibt aber einfach hängen und liefert auch keinen Wert, wenn der Adapter gestartet wurde.
Bei einem Reboot des Servers ist nicht sichergestellt, dass der History-Adapter vor meinem Adapter gestartet wird. Daher wäre es gut, wenn die Startreihenfolge der Adapter festgelegt werden könnte.
Workaround ist, den Alive-Value des Adapters in einer Schleife abzufragen und nach einer gewissen Zeit dann abzubrechen.
Aus meiner Sicht müsste die Funktion aber selber ein Abbruch Kriterium haben.
Hey! Du scheinst an dieser Unterhaltung interessiert zu sein, hast aber noch kein Konto.
Hast du es satt, bei jedem Besuch durch die gleichen Beiträge zu scrollen? Wenn du dich für ein Konto anmeldest, kommst du immer genau dorthin zurück, wo du zuvor warst, und kannst dich über neue Antworten benachrichtigen lassen (entweder per E-Mail oder Push-Benachrichtigung). Du kannst auch Lesezeichen speichern und Beiträge positiv bewerten, um anderen Community-Mitgliedern deine Wertschätzung zu zeigen.
Mit deinem Input könnte dieser Beitrag noch besser werden 💗
Registrieren Anmelden